6.3.5.4: asparagine synthase (glutamine-hydrolysing)

This is an abbreviated version!
For detailed information about asparagine synthase (glutamine-hydrolysing), go to the full flat file.

Word Map on EC 6.3.5.4

Reaction

ATP
+
L-aspartate
+
L-glutamine
+
H2O
=
AMP
+
diphosphate
+
L-asparagine
+
L-glutamate

Synonyms

AS, AS-A, AS-B, AS1, ASN3, AsnA, ASNase, AsnB, ASNS, AsnS1, AsnS2, AsnS3, AsnS4, asparagine amidotransferase, Asparagine synthetase, Asparagine synthetase (glutamine hydrolyzing), Asparagine synthetase (glutamine), Asparagine synthetase (glutamine-hydrolysing), asparagine synthetase 1, asparagine synthetase 2, Asparagine synthetase A, Asparagine synthetase B, asparagine synthetase, glutamine-dependent, asparagine synthetase1, asparagine synthetase2, At5g10240, bacterial type asparagine synthetase A, CaAS1, glutamine-dependent amidotransferase, Glutamine-dependent asparagine synthetase, HvAS1 protein, HvAS2 protein, HvASN1, HvASN2, HvASN3, HvASN4, HvASN5, L-asparaginase, L-Asparagine synthetase, LDBPK_300470, LiAS-A, MLOC_37219, MLOC_44080, MLOC_63089, MLOC_72774, MLOC_75057, More, NAS2, Os03g0291500, Os06g0265000, OsAS1, OsAS2, PVAS1 protein, PVAS2, Ste10, Synthetase, Asn (glutamine), TaASN1, TaASN2, TaASN4, TaSN1, TaSN2, TS11 cell cycle control protein, type -II asparagine synthetase, type I asparagine synthetase, type II asparagine synthetase

ECTree

     6 Ligases
         6.3 Forming carbon-nitrogen bonds
             6.3.5 Carbon-nitrogen ligases with glutamine as amido-N-donor
                6.3.5.4 asparagine synthase (glutamine-hydrolysing)
